Royal & Derngate, Arts centre in Northampton, England
Royal & Derngate is an arts center in Northampton with two connected theater spaces designed to host different types of performances and productions. The complex includes a cinema, café, and additional spaces for exhibitions and other cultural events.
The theater with the older name was designed in the 1880s as an elaborate building and has over a century of history. The second theater space was built about a century later, and the two were eventually united under shared management.
The venue serves as a gathering place where the local community comes together to experience theater, music, and dance performances throughout the year. The spaces are regularly used for workshops and classes where visitors can participate in creative activities.

The building with the older name was designed by a celebrated Victorian architect famous for his theater designs. Its ornate interior decoration and handcrafted details from that era remain visible to visitors today.
